Golf Tournament Registration Still Open

Register here for the 10th Hawks Booster Club and Alumni Golf Tournament.

Come out and participate in our four-player Florida Scramble at Bear Creek Golf Club (near DFW Airport) on June 1.

How a Florida Scramble is played: each player tees off on each hole. The best of the tee shots is selected and all players play their second shots from that spot. The best of the second shots is determined, then all play their third shots from that spot, and so on until the ball is holed. In other words, EVERYONE can participate and be a great golfer for the day!

Cost: $175 for adults and $140 for students. Entry fee includes green fees, cart, range balls and dinner.

Dotson Wins Work of Heart Award

Mr. Malcolm Dotson has received the "Work of Heart" Award from the Catholic Foundation. Work of Heart recipients are selected from written nominations submitted to the Catholic Foundation and judged based on traditional merit criteria including tenure and leadership, acts of kindness or charity, Christian example, mentoring and simply going the extra mile for an individual student, family or the community.

Mr. Ed M. Schaffler, President of the Catholic Foundation, states that "In each of our local Catholic schools, teachers, mentors and role models make a positive difference in the lives of children. Whether it is in the classroom, the front office or the hallway, there are educators and staff members who go above and beyond. The Catholic Foundation is honored to provide them with a special thank you and extra recognition for their service. We hope other parents and community members will join us in this show of appreciation."

In addition to his coaching duties, Mr. Dotson is the PE instructor for Form I, and he teaches Form II Computer. He is completing his sixth year at Cistercian.
